UK must be ready to leave EU without a deal: leadership contender Raab
Dominic Raab attends "A Better Deal" event in London/ Dominic Raab, former Secretary of State for Exiting the European Union attends "A Better Deal" event in London, Britain, January 15, 2018. REUTERS/Eddie Keogh/ LONDON (Reuters) - Britain must be ready to leave the European Union without an exit deal on Oct. 31, former Brexit minister Dominic Raab said on Sunday, as he set out his pitch to succeed Theresa May as prime minister. "If you're not willing to walk away from a negotiation, it doesn't focus the mind of the other side," Raab told ...
